MySQL备份数据库命令(Windows)

MySQL是一个广泛使用的关系型数据库管理系统,它的备份是数据库管理的一个重要部分。在Windows操作系统下,我们可以使用命令行工具来备份MySQL数据库。本文将介绍如何使用命令行工具备份MySQL数据库,并提供相应的代码示例。

准备工作

在开始备份之前,我们需要确保已经安装了MySQL数据库,并且将其添加到系统环境变量中。此外,还需要确认已经设置了MySQL的用户名和密码,以便于登录数据库。

备份命令

我们可以使用mysqldump命令来备份MySQL数据库。mysqldump是MySQL的一个命令行工具,可以将数据库的结构和数据导出到一个文件中。以下是备份命令的基本格式:

mysqldump -u [用户名] -p [密码] [数据库名] > [备份文件路径]
  • -u参数用于指定用户名;
  • -p参数用于指定密码;
  • [数据库名]是要备份的数据库的名称;
  • [备份文件路径]是备份文件保存的路径。

示例

接下来,我们将以一个示例来演示如何备份MySQL数据库。假设我们要备份的数据库名为mydatabase,用户名为root,密码为password,备份文件保存在C:\backup\mydatabase.sql

步骤1:打开命令提示符

首先,打开Windows的命令提示符。你可以按下Win + R键,然后输入cmd并按下Enter键来打开命令提示符。

步骤2:切换到MySQL安装目录

在命令提示符中,我们需要切换到MySQL的安装目录。假设MySQL的安装路径为C:\MySQL,可以使用以下命令切换到该目录:

cd C:\MySQL\bin

步骤3:执行备份命令

在MySQL的安装目录下,执行以下命令来备份数据库:

mysqldump -u root -p password mydatabase > C:\backup\mydatabase.sql

在执行该命令后,系统会提示输入密码。输入正确的密码后,回车即可开始备份。

步骤4:验证备份文件

备份完成后,可以打开C:\backup\mydatabase.sql文件,验证是否成功备份了数据库。该文件是一个纯文本文件,可以使用文本编辑器打开查看。

流程图

下面是备份过程的流程图:

flowchart TD
    A[打开命令提示符] --> B[切换到MySQL安装目录]
    B --> C[执行备份命令]
    C --> D[验证备份文件]

关系图

备份数据库的命令并不涉及具体的数据库结构和数据,因此不需要绘制关系图。

总结

通过本文,我们了解了如何在Windows操作系统下使用命令行工具备份MySQL数据库。备份命令的格式是mysqldump -u [用户名] -p [密码] [数据库名] > [备份文件路径]。我们通过一个示例演示了整个备份过程,并绘制了相应的流程图。备份数据库是非常重要的,它可以帮助我们在数据丢失或者数据库崩溃时恢复数据。希望本文能对你备份MySQL数据库有所帮助。